Morningstar's Compliance team supports Morningstar's global business entities, primarily focusing on those registered with and governed by regulatory authorities. Our compliance professionals help each Morningstar business entity adhere to the rules and regulations of the local regulatory authorities.
The Role:
Morningstar's Compliance team is currently seeking a highly motivated Compliance Director to join our team. The primary focus of the role is to oversee the daily administration of the compliance program for the Morningstar Wealth, Retirement, and Research groups located in the United States. This position is based in Chicago and reports to Morningstar's Chief Compliance Officer, Americas - Wealth, Retirement, and Research.
Key Responsibilities:
- Design, implement, and oversee the compliance program for United States-based regulated entities under the Investment Advisers and Investment Company Acts
- Administer and support local and global controls compliance team activities regarding policies and procedures, advisory agreements, registrations, regulatory filings, disclosures, training, monitoring and testing, customer complaints, and risk assessments
- Manage relationships with clients and regulators on material compliance matters
- Stay informed of regulatory developments, respond to regulatory inquiries, and facilitate regulatory examinations
- Provide advice to employees on material compliance and regulatory matters and respond to escalated questions from business units
- Supply guidance on new products/services or material changes to the business model
- Monitor implemented updates by business units due to regulatory or compliance policy changes
- Prepare and present informal and formal training sessions on complex topics
- Oversee and mentor the United States compliance team
- Support the United States compliance team with other tasks, initiatives, or projects, as directed
- Promote a culture of compliance
Requirements:
- Bachelor's degree. Advanced degree and/or relevant certifications a plus
- 8+ years' compliance experience with investment adviser and investment company regulations
- Solid understanding of and experience with applicable advisory services, regulatory environment, rules and regulations (Advisers Act, Investment Company Act, ERISA), and implementing policies and procedures for new or changing regulations
- Experience with all facets of a compliance program and successful implementation of courses of action
- Excellent verbal and writing skills that enable messages and decisions to be articulated confidently, effectively, and diplomatically across all levels of the business
- Provide well-informed guidance backed by strong knowledge and analysis of the issue
- Strong commitment to providing support to the compliance team, internal customers (management, businesses, products, etc.), and protecting the company and stakeholders
- Ability to consistently apply and display a reasonable and mature approach in critical thinking by being able to independently assemble, evaluate, and apply logical reasoning to information
- Strong organizational and project management skills with the flexibility to respond to changing priorities
- Robust interpersonal skills and ability to work effectively in a team environment
- Ability to manage multiple projects and deadlines simultaneously
- High degree of integrity and strong work ethic
- Attention to detail and highly organized
- Strong leadership/management experience
- Experience leading a monitoring and testing function a plus

What you need to know about the Colorado Tech Scene
With a business-friendly climate and research universities like CU Boulder and Colorado State, Colorado has made a name for itself as a startup ecosystem. The state boasts a skilled workforce and high quality of life thanks to its affordable housing, vibrant cultural scene and unparalleled opportunities for outdoor recreation. Colorado is also home to the National Renewable Energy Laboratory, helping cement its status as a hub for renewable energy innovation.
Key Facts About Colorado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 260,000; 8.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Lockheed Martin, Century Link, Comcast, BAE Systems, Level 3
- Key Industries: Software, artificial intelligence, aerospace, e-commerce, fintech, healthtech
- Funding Landscape: $4.9 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Access Venture Partners, Ridgeline Ventures, Techstars, Blackhorn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: Colorado School of Mines, University of Colorado Boulder, University of Denver, Colorado State University, Mesa Laboratory, Space Science Institute, National Center for Atmospheric Research, National Renewable Energy Laboratory, Gottlieb Institute
